The Salvation Army of Syracuse, New York, is a resource dedicated to providing essential support and services to individuals experiencing homelessness. This includes emergency shelter, transitional housing, and permanent supportive housing. The organization aims to not only provide immediate relief to those in need, but also to address the underlying issues contributing to chronic homelessness - such as unemployment, lack of education, and healthcare. Through a holistic approach to care, they strive to help individuals regain their independence and successfully reenter society.
